University Interview Experiences in Kamla Nehru Institute of Technology
Located in the Sultanpur district of Uttar Pradesh, KNIT is one of the leading autonomous technical educational institutions in Lucknow affiliated to Dr. A. P. J. Abdul Kalam Technical University. The college is accredited by AICTE and NBA for a large number of courses. In total, KNIT offers 21 courses under UG, PG, and Doctoral programmes for different disciplines of Science such as Civil, Mechanical, Computer Science, Electronics, Electrical, etc. These include B.Tech, M.Tech, M.Tech (part-time), MCA and Ph.D. courses. The M.Tech (part-time) and other doctoral programmes are available to engineers working in the surrounding areas who want to further their education or sharpen their skills.
Admission to KNIT
Admissions to all the above-mentioned courses are merit-based on the performance of the students in the UPSEE-AKTU examination and counselling. However, presently, the UPSEEAKTU examination has been discarded, and the students will be admitted to different courses through different national-level examinations. For example, the admissions in B.Tech will be done through JEE Mains and through CUET for other UG and PG programmes. The results of only these examinations will be valid in all AKTU affiliated colleges, which includes KNIT, Sultanpur as well. After the publishing of results/score cards, the students can approach their desired colleges and seek admission to the same. KNIT has autonomy in framing instructions, methods of evaluation, examinations or any other activities related to the students’ admission after the National Level Entrance Test (CUET/JEE Mains). However, the result/degree/diploma/award afterwards is entirely in the hands of the university and thus offered by Dr. A. P. J. Abdul Kalam Technical University to the students of KNIT, Sultanpur. The counselling procedures after the entrance test are also solely in the hands of the university.

There are no specific interview rounds mentioned in the counselling steps or procedures, but students may be asked some questions about their course interests or reason for choice after seat allocation. When students visit the college after getting their seat of choice for admissions, the admissions officer may have a few questions ready for them. Students may appear unconcerned because this would not result in the cancellation of their admissions, but rather as a routine activity to learn more about the student.
Here is a list of some frequently asked questions by the officer responsible for admissions:
- What prompted you to enrol in the following course?
- What are your future prospects regarding the course choice you are making?
- Did you have another course in mind if you weren't admitted to this one?
- What are your interests and hobbies?
- What can you do to help this college?
The above questions are not compulsory, and so is the interview. The admission officer may or may not be interested in interviewing you, but you must keep in mind the following points:
- Always go in formal-washed and ironed clothes even though you haven’t got the admission yet.
- Reach on time as there would be a long list of candidates.
- Carry all your documents prepared in different sets-one original and one Xerox.
- Take a tour of the college ahead of time so that any questions can be answered right away.
- Inquire about your class schedule and other academic questions.

Yes, you can pursue MCA at KNIT-Sultanpur with a B.Sc in Biology. KNIT's eligibility for MCA requires a Bachelor's degree in any discipline with a minimum of fifty percent marks, and admission is based on your CUET PG scores.
